Hollywood Cemetery

412 South Cherry Street, Richmond, VA 23220

Check our President James Monroe's Tomb, visit President John Tyler's Monument, or just take a stroll through a shady, well-loved tourist location on the James River.

The Poe Museum

1914 East Main Street, Richmond, VA 23223

The Old Stone House is the oldest residential building that is still standing in Richmond, Virginia. It currently houses an exhibit about Poe’s childhood in Richmond. Although Edgar Allan Poe never lived in the Old Stone House, he still had connections to the home itself and its surrounding neighborhood.
